Auto Accidents

You may have suffered severe injuries from an accident, which has left you without work and battling rent and other expenses. Your New York injury attorney near me attorneys can help you fight for the compensation you're due. They will serve as your advocate throughout the entire process, negotiating with insurance companies and presenting you case to a judge when necessary.

Your lawyer will first go to the scene of the accident to collect evidence, like skid marks, vehicle damage, witness statements medical records etc. Then, they'll go through your medical records to determine the extent of your injuries and losses. They will consider both financial and non-financial losses. Financial losses can include medical treatment, prescriptions and surgeries and other medical aids and treatments like wheelchairs or crutches. This includes lost wages due the time off work caused by your injuries.

Non-financial damages are those that result from suffering and pain, which covers your emotional trauma and any difficulties you face in coping with your injuries or car accident. Your injury lawyers can calculate the total amount of economic and noneconomic damage you've suffered and negotiate a settlement with the insurer of the party who is at the fault.

When building your claim, your New York auto accident lawyers will look at the various ways that your injuries and accident have affected your life. This means taking into account the long-term effects of your injuries, in addition to current and future costs, as they will consider how much money you'll need to be able to live comfortably in the years to come.

Many accident cases involve multiple parties. For instance, the producer and distributor of a defective product or your doctor and their hospital could be jointly responsible for your injuries. In these cases, the court assigns a percentage of blame to each party and decides on damages based on that. If, for instance the doctor or hospital was only 5% responsible for your injuries, you would receive 95%.

Traumatic Brain Injury

Traumatic brain injury (TBI) has a devastating effect on the families of victims. They are typically disabled from work and are forced to pay for medical care. Depending on the severity of the injury is, it could cause a loss of cognitive or motor function. It can also lead to physical anxiety, depression, pain and memory issues and headaches, as well as fatigue. The most frequent causes of TBI are accidents in the car, falls and assaults.
